Stephanie B.

One of my favorite go-to places in the neighborhood. Food: I have tried a couple of their soups and all of them have been delicious! For $4, you get a nice portion of their soup of the day plus a piece of bread for dipping. Past favorites include: lentil, vegetable soup, and broccoli cream. I've also tried their sandwiches and wraps, which you can customize as you please. Smoothies and Juices: Great variety, fresh ingredients, and the ability to customize them with whatever your heart desires. I really like the banana chocolate with himalayan salt as well as their "almond joy," which is made with almonds, dates, and agave syrup. Bowls: I love their acai and pitaya bowls! If you've never had one, they're basically healthy smoothie bowls topped with fruits. For $8, you get a bowl plus up to four toppings. I tend to get the pitaya bowl with mango, strawberries, granola, and bananas. So yummy! Staff: Both of the ladies who work at Green Leafs are lovely and super nice. :) Bonus: They have a loyalty card via an app called Perka, where if you drink 10 smoothies, you get one free. Wifi is good and strong should you like to work from there. There's also an upstairs area. Highly welcomed addition to the neighborhood. Check them out!
